摘要
The iron nanowires were obtained by DC electrochemical method in nanoporous anodic alumina templates (MO). For stability tests these materials were placed in different solutions: white wine, citric acid, 0.9% NaCl, distilled water and ethanol for a 1-3 week time period. The results of such treatment (solubility or possible changes on the surface) of the Fe nanowires were measured by IR (infrared spectroscopy), ASA (atomic absorption spectroscopy), TEM (transmission electron microscopy), XRD (X-ray diffraction) and DSC (differential scanning calorimetry) methods.
